Make -proxy set all network types, avoiding a connect leak.

Previously -proxy was not setting the proxy for IsLimited networks, so
 if you set your configuration to be onlynet=tor you wouldn't get an
 IPv4 proxy set.

The payment protocol gets its proxy configuration from the IPv4 proxy,
 and so it would experience a connection leak.

This addresses issue #5355 and also clears up a cosmetic bug where
 getinfo proxy output shows nothing when onlynet=tor is set.
